Ectaco’s jetBook Lite Comes in Cheap – $149
Can Asus beat Ectaco’s jetBook Lite’s ebook reader’s price of $149? Well Asus and even MSI better have their ebook readers lower than $149 if they want it to be called affordable ebook readers. jetBook Lite is now only cheap but it also supports various ebook file formats including ePub, Mobi, PRC, RTF, .txt, .pdf, .fb2, .jpg, .gif, .png, and .bmp.The jetBook Lite supports various languages including English, Spanish, Russian, Polish, Chinese and others. Users can download books directly from Barnes and Nobles ebookstore as well.
Here are the features of the the jetBook Lite ebook reader:
- Support for e-Book contents in Russian, Polish, English, Spanish and other languages
- Bidirectional dictionaries for certain European languages are available
- Supports books in all popular, widely used formats
- Bookmarks and auto page turn functionality
- Adjustable font type and size
- Screen rotation support for both portrait & landscape modes
- Built-in MP3 player that supports background playback
- SD card slot
- Internal Li-ion polymer battery
Technical specs of the jetBook Lite are as follow:
- 5-inch VGA reflective monochrome screen
- 7.5 oz.
- built in flash-memory
- SD slot up to 2GB in size
- T9 text input
- 20 hours battery life.
jetBook-Lite is expected to appear in US retail stores later this month. European release is scheduled for spring 2010.
